1. • Stability is calculated by comparing energy of the bulk Perovskite to that of the PbI2
precipitate and salt (using Abinit code)
• The formability of the new perovskite is checked by using the Goldschmidt tolerance factor
(favourable structures are 0.76<t<1.13)[6]
• The band structures were calculated using Wien2k code
• The synthesis is done by mixing the solutions of Pb(NO)3 and excess of (CH3NH3)I[3]
• Addition of water to the perovskites results in decomposition as shown below[4]
• Current methods protect the Perovskite with polymer coating[5]
• Our approach to resolve this issue is to modify the material itself

• New emerging photovoltaic material
(CH3NH3)PbI3in the Perovskite form
ABX3
• Perovskite has shown impressive
increases in efficiency in the past 3
years
• Known for high charge carrier mobilities,
high efficiency and other favorable photovoltaic properties[1] [2]
• Even though the LCOE for photovoltaic systems have dropped
exponentially since the 70’s the initial cost is still high enough to
deter people from investing
• The Perovskite material can be solution processed instead of the
conventional lithographic etchants on ultra thin wafers, this could
reduce the cost of production even further[1]
• Manipulation of the cation shows a direct link to both the stability and the band structures of
the material
• The secret to the stability of the Perovskite is not is the extra coatings needed to protect the
material but within the structure of the material itself
• The next step is to create a process for the synthesis of the material, along with creating the
actual material
